ZIP code 41056 is assigned to Maysville, KY, and falls within Mason County. Like every US postal code, it began as a mail-routing device rather than a geographic boundary — the US Postal Service groups delivery routes under a single code so carriers and sorting equipment can process mail efficiently. Today it also serves as a practical shorthand for the area itself: roughly 13,978 people live inside it.
At 100 residents per square mile spread over 139.505 square miles, 41056 reads as a rural area. It is a mid-sized postal code by population, and density shapes almost everything else on this page — how people get to work, whether they own or rent, and what housing costs.
Household earnings run below the national median. At $49,549, 41056 sits in the lower half, ahead of 15% of them. The US median for comparison is $70,109. Bear in mind that median income describes the midpoint household, not the average — it is not pulled upward by a handful of very high earners the way a mean would be.
Living here
What life in Maysville looks like
Housing in 41056 costs below the national median. A typical home is valued at $158,700 against a US median of $207,500, and median gross rent runs $716 a month. The split between owning and renting is fairly even at 64.6% owner-occupied, which tends to indicate a mix of housing types rather than one dominant form.
The building stock is dominated by detached single-family houses, which account for 69.2% of housing units here. The median construction year is 1974, making the housing here from the later twentieth century.
The population skews broadly in line with the national age profile, with a median age of 42.4 against 42 nationally. The average household holds 2.4 people, and 60.8% are family households.
Getting to work takes 23.6 minutes on average one way. The dominant mode is drove alone at 87.9% of workers.

Practical uses
What ZIP code 41056 is used for
Beyond addressing mail, 41056 does a lot of quiet administrative work. Retailers use it to calculate shipping and sales tax at checkout. Insurers use it to set premiums, since risk profiles vary geographically. Employers and marketers use it to define service areas. Government agencies use it to route benefits and organise reporting. If you have ever been asked for a postal code by a form that clearly does not intend to send you anything, this is why.
For anyone weighing a move, 41056 offers a compact profile of Maysville: 13,978 residents, a median household income of $49,549, 20.9% of adults holding a bachelor's degree or higher, and an unemployment rate of 5.2%. A handful of figures like these answer more relocation questions than most neighbourhood guides do.
One caution worth repeating: a postal code is not a neighbourhood. 41056 may cover parts of several distinct areas, and a single neighbourhood in Maysville may be split across more than one code. Boundaries also shift as USPS adjusts delivery routes. Treat the figures here as describing a delivery area, which is what they actually measure.
